# Break-Glass Access: Currency Rounding Incidents

Scope: Skellan Pay conversion service producing sub-cent rounding drift.

Use break-glass only if the drift exceeds reconciliation tolerance and the Marloweg ledger is diverging. Page the finance lead first. Access grants auto-expire after two hours and are logged to Fenholt audit.

To open the break-glass credential store on the Corvane bastion, enter the recovery passphrase printed directly below this line.

vault phrase of bagaf-kajeg = jorath-feniel-briir-siliel-ralix

Handover Note — Marketing Directorate, Fenlow & Carrow Ltd

For the incoming director: please review the marketing budget reduction approved last quarter. Spend drops 18%, concentrated in print and the Harlowe Fair sponsorship; digital retention campaigns for the Brightwick product line are protected. I have documented vendor commitments and exit penalties in the shared ledger, and flagged two contracts needing renegotiation before June. Context for these cuts sits in the confidential note that follows.

board note of fahog-bawep: The renewal with Holixax Holdings closes at $20 million a year, 20 percent below the last contract. Project Druwyn slips by two quarters because of the supplier delay.

# Blue-green cutover constants for the Tallowmere billing worker.
#
# Heads up: these control how fast we drain the blue pool and warm the
# green one during a cutover. The billing worker holds in-flight charge
# batches, so draining too fast risks double-submits and draining too
# slow blows past the maintenance window. We learned both lessons the
# hard way last quarter. If you bump anything here, ping the on-call
# before the next release train. The values we settled on are below.

tuning constants:
QUOTAS = {
    "druwyn": 5,
    "holix": 5,
    "zorath": 5,
    "holwyn": 10,
}